How they compare

Republic of Korea currently reports 5.1% against 5.1% in Sri Lanka, a difference of 0.0%.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 16 shared years of data; in 2004 it was Republic of Korea ahead.

Republic of Korea ranks 85th and Sri Lanka ranks 85th of 187 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Republic of Korea averaged higher in 1 and Sri Lanka in 1.

The cost is the total of official costs associated with completing the procedures to transfer the property, expressed as a percentage of the property value, assumed to be equiva­lent to 50 times income per capita. It is calculted as a percentage of the property value. Only official costs required by law are recorded, including fees, transfer taxes, stamp duties and any other payment to the property registry, notaries, public agencies or lawyers. Other taxes, such as capital gains tax or value added tax, are excluded from the cost measure. Both costs borne by the buyer and the seller are included. If cost estimates differ among sources, the median reported value is used.
